Programme of the much awaited Anti-Sanction Day pencilled for the 25th of October, was yesterday presented before cabinet by Vice President Kembo Mohadi who highlighted that the day would be filled with solidarity messages from local and international speakers and a lot of entertainment.

Director of Climate Change Management in the Ministry of Lands, Agriculture, Water, Climate and Rural Resettlement, Washington Zhakata has said climate change is one of the biggest threats facing the global economy hence the need to make people knowledgeable and safe.

Thousands of people from over 300 Church Denominations and Government institutions have today gathered at the State House for a National Day of Prayer which was spearheaded by the First Lady, Auxillia Mnangagwa.

Renovations of Cold Storage Company (CSC) by a British Company Bousted Beef are underway in Bulawayo. The renovations are expected to be finished by the first week of January 2020, The Harare Post can report.
